They are all a little modified.

The Lexus just got the suspension of the newer model. The ride on the autobahn at highspeed is much better now. I also changed the yellow side markers into white ones. I will change the bumper lights and the back lights. I also just got 17" Lexus Rims with 235/45ZR17 tires.

The VR6 is colored in darkburgundyperleffect which is a special color for this Golf. It has grey leather, Eibach springs, Hartmann "Fächerkrümmer" I don't know whats it called in english. Grille w/o VW sign, big VR6 Frontspoiler,BBS 16" wheels,
wood steering wheel and interiour.
And a lot of little interiour changes. The car is fully loaded.

The Cabrio is black/black fully loaded 2.0l with minor changes.
